3614 – Theft in Sint Maarten (Kingdom of the Netherlands) – Simpson Bay


Incident Date: 2025-03-06 at 11:00

Event Type: Theft

Stolen Items: Rib dinghy / Yamaha 15HP engine

Secured: Not Locked

Source Type: 1st Hand Report

Incident Details: UPDATED REPORT : Victims have made contact and filed a firsthand report. ||Cruisers tied their dinghy to the Dutch Customs dock by the bridge at 1100HRS and went inside to complete formalities. Almost immediately the dinghy was stolen. Video surveillance captured the lurking thief and his rapid departure to the lagoon. ||The victims discovered the theft at 1400HRS when they returned to the dinghy dock after doing some errands .They immediately returned to the Customs office. Officials there contacted an inspector from the governmental Ministry of Tourism, Economic Affairs, Traffic and Telecommunications, the police and the Coast Guard on their behalf. The Ministry inspector arrived 2 hours later, the police 3 hours later and took reports. ||The victims made a report the next morning on the VHF net. Officials shared video surveillance / video footage with them. No follow-up from police or other officials has been made 4 days later. ||Dinghy : Highfield 310 classic. 3522 – Theft in Sint Maarten (Kingdom of the Netherlands) – Simpson Bay


Incident Date: 2025-01-22 at 23:00

Event Type: Theft

Stolen Items: Highfield 290 center console dinghy / 20HP Honda outboard. Hull ID: CN-HFM 42759 D425. Engine SN: BAMJ-1558405

Secured: Not Locked

Source Type: 1st Hand Report

Incident Details: Between 2230 and 0300HRS an in-the-water and not locked dinghy was stolen from a yacht anchored in Simpson Bay while owners slept onboard. A search was made, without result. A police report was made.||UPDATE: Dinghy was found 24 January severely damaged. It was apparent the thieves had encountered difficulty removing the engine and chose to destroy both the engine and dinghy before it was abandoned. ||Highfield 290 center console Hull ID: CN-HFM 42759 D42| 20HP Honda outboard SN: BAMJ-1558405

3436 – Burglary in Sint Maarten (Kingdom of the Netherlands) – Simpson Bay Lagoon


Incident Date: 2024-12-08 at 18:30

Event Type: Burglary

Stolen Items: Cash, all electrical devices and cables, and a backpack

Secured: Locked

Source Type: 1st Hand Report

Incident Details: A catamaran in the Dutch lagoon that experienced a boarding 2 days prior was boarded a second time and burgled between 1630-1930HRS. The thieves came prepared with tools and broke in through the locked doorway. ||The entire yacht was ransacked and the thieves stole cash, all electrical devices and cables, and a backpack to carry it all in. Reports were made to police and Coast Guard in both jurisdictions. Live tracking data for the stolen devices was provided.||UPDATE : Some of the stolen items have been recovered/returned by another cruiser who tracked his own stolen dinghy, see 3441.
